What is Hard Water?


Difficult water is characterized by its mineral content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the supply of water as it percolates via limestone and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is heated or entrusted to stand, it tends to form range, a crusty buildup that abides by surface areas and can trigger a series of concerns in plumbing systems.

Effect on Water lines


Tough water influences pipelines in numerous destructive methods, primarily through range build-up, decreased water flow, and enhanced deterioration.

Scale Buildup


One of one of the most common issues caused by difficult water is scale accumulation inside pipelines and components. As water moves via the plumbing system, minerals precipitate out and adhere to the pipe walls. Over time, this buildup can narrow pipeline openings, bring about lowered water circulation and boosted pressure on the system.

Decreased Water Flow


Natural resources from hard water can progressively decrease the diameter of pipelines, limiting water flow to faucets, showers, and devices. This minimized circulation not only affects water stress however also raises energy consumption as appliances like hot water heater should function more challenging to deliver the very same amount of warm water.

Rust


While tough water minerals themselves do not create corrosion, they can aggravate existing corrosion concerns in pipes. Scale build-up can trap water versus metal surface areas, increasing the deterioration process and potentially resulting in leakages or pipe failing with time.

Appliance Damage


Past pipelines, difficult water can additionally harm home appliances linked to the supply of water. Appliances such as hot water heater, dish washers, and cleaning makers are particularly prone to scale buildup. This can reduce their efficiency, boost maintenance costs, and reduce their life-span.

Examining and Therapy


Testing for hard water and carrying out appropriate therapy measures is vital to mitigating its effects on pipes and home appliances.

Water Softeners


Water softeners are the most typical option for dealing with hard water. They work by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ully lowering the firmness of the water.

Other Therapy Choices


Along with water conditioners, other therapy options include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each approach has its advantages and viability depending upon the intensity of the hard water trouble and home requ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
